A volume in Contemporary Perspectives in Special EducationSeries Editors: Anthony F. Rotatori, Saint Xavier Universityand Festus E. Obiakor, Valdosta State UnivversityThe purpose of this book is to provide a forum for an interdisciplinary scholarly dialogue with regard to preparingteachers for early childhood special education. In addition, it is aimed at examining and making available relevant andmost recent scholarship to practitioners and at addressing critical issues and perspectives around preparing effectiveeducators for the 21 century classroom and the future. This book intends to illuminate a complex and challenging task ofpreparing effective educators through the lenses of several educational disciplines, including but not limited to, teacher education, general education, special education,early childhood education, and urban education.The information in this work will focus on several educational disciplines that have the most immediate implications for teacher preparation and practice. The overalleducational knowledge base will be enhanced due to the educational interdisciplinary approach. This has additional implications for teacher education, special education,educational leadership, curriculum and instruction, educational policy, and urban education, to name a few. The multidimensional nature of the book gives it the freedomto highlight multiple and diverse voices while at the same time providing a forum for different (and sometimes divergent) methodologies, philosophies, and ideologies.
